pre surgery stuff in order?????

I'm spending this day preparing my presurgery checklists -- just wanted to offer, if you haven't had a chance be sure to check out the section Lap Band FAQs and References especially the thread called Post Op Cheklists and Things to Have Before Surgery. There is a print button. Go through the list and pre plan. (I feel like my program really has prepared me that throughly for the actual surgery, its this forum that has :)). I learned and will tomorrow ask for a pain medication prescription presurgery -- so it will be there when you need it, alot of pharmacies need extra time to order liquid meds, who knew.) The one thing I disagree with don't get a manicure or pedicure pre surgery in fact remove all nail polish. You want to go into surgery the way you arrived in the world -- think baby naked.

Hello again...

According to my doc's office, I will meet with him and the nutritionist the same day. I can, if I want, schedule to meet with the psych doc the same day as well. His office is around the block from my Lap Band doc's office. The nutritionist said that most people from their office schedule all of their appointments the same day to get them over with especially if you don't live in San Antonio. I will probably just meet with the lap doc and nutritionist on one day and the psych and lab work on another day. As with any other, just have to have it all done before surgery to be cleared. If you are self pay, they will do the surgery anywhere from 8 days-2 weeks after your initial consult.

That is why it is possible for me to have surgery in May, but still have to get the financing. Hope the financing issue does not throw me into a later date. I will keep you all posted. Later!
